Company Profile

Cross Creek is an independently owned venture capital firm based in Salt Lake City, Utah, specializing in bridging the gap between private and public markets. The firm focuses on late-stage growth equity investments and also employs a fund-of-funds strategy, targeting companies poised for transition from private to public ownership. With a significant track record, Cross Creek aims to identify and support innovative companies with sustainable growth prospects, leveraging its expertise to guide them through the complexities of public offerings and acquisitions.

Founded in 2006 by Karey Barker, Cross Creek initially operated within Wasatch Advisors before becoming an independent entity in 2012. Barker, who previously managed small-cap public growth funds at Wasatch, recognized the increasing trend of private companies going public later in their life cycles. She established Cross Creek to capture value creation earlier in this process, building a firm dedicated to late-stage venture-backed companies and top-tier venture funds.

The firm's diverse portfolio includes notable investments across various sectors. Key portfolio companies have included HubSpot, DocuSign, Angi (formerly Angie's List), Gusto, and Scopely. Cross Creek's investment focus spans healthcare technology, marketplaces and consumer internet, enterprise software, cybersecurity, and manufacturing and supply chain. They target Series C and later funding rounds, seeking businesses with proven models, exceptional management teams, and potential for near-term liquidity.

Cross Creek's senior investment team, which has been working together since 2010, brings diverse public and private sector expertise. The team includes founding and managing partners like Karey Barker, Tyler Christenson, and Peter Jarman, alongside a dedicated group of investment professionals, investor relations specialists, and operations staff. Their collective experience and strategic guidance are integral to supporting portfolio companies and facilitating their successful transition to public markets.
